Text

Except as provided in § 36-10B-15 , no person may practice nutrition and dietetics or provide nutrition care services unless licensed or otherwise authorized to practice under this chapter. No person may practice as a licensed nutritionist, use the title nutritionist, dietitian, or licensed nutritionist, or use the abbreviation LN, unless licensed under this chapter. A licensed nutritionist may use the title licensed nutritionist and the abbreviation LN. A violation of this section is a Class 2 misdemeanor. A dietitian registered by the Commission on Dietetic Registration may use the title registered dietitian and the designation RD.
